Product

Guardian Connect App CSS7200 iOS and Guardian Connect Transmitter GST4C used on the iPhone, iPad and iPod Touch devices.

Reason

Customers using the firm's continuous glucose monitoring system application on an iPhone, iPad or iPod Touch with ios software version 12, 12.1, or 12,2 are likely to experience a shortened transmitter battery life (approximately 4-5 days instead of the normal 7 days or more) after a full charge.

Identifiers

code_info
Model Number CSS7200 (Guardian Connect App: iOS); Catalog Numbers: MMT-7821 (Guardian Connect Transmitter - GST4C); UPN…Model Number CSS7200 (Guardian Connect App: iOS); Catalog Numbers: MMT-7821 (Guardian Connect Transmitter - GST4C); UPN - 00763000186333. There are no assigned lot or serial numbers.
